Compare all specifications:
1981 Mazda RX-7 | 1972 Volvo 1800 | |
Make | Mazda | Volvo |
Model | RX-7 | 1800 |
Year Released | 1981 | 1972 |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 2292 cc | 1984 cc |
Engine Type | dual-disk rotary | in-line |
Horse Power | 104 HP | 96 HP |
Engine RPM | 6000 RPM | 6000 RPM |
Torque | 145 Nm | 153 Nm |
Torque RPM | 4000 RPM | 3500 RPM |
Fuel Type | Gasoline | Gasoline |
Drive Type | Rear | Rear |
Vehicle Weight | 1060 kg | 1190 kg |
Vehicle Length | 4300 mm | 4400 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1680 mm | 1710 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1280 mm | 1300 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2430 mm | 2460 mm |
